Entry Level Electrical Designer Location: Mount Laurel State/Territory: New Jersey Department: Power Delivery Mt Laurel Substation Dept
Description Entry Level Electrical Designer Job Summary
POWER Engineers is currently seeking an Electrical Designer to work in the Power Delivery Substation Department in our Mount Laurel, New Jersey office. Flexibility is available for a hybrid work environment (employee will need to live within driving distance of the office).
Roles and Responsibilities- The position involves drafting, modeling, and design opportunities on electric utility substation projects.
- The successful candidate will be responsible for learning, understanding, and implementing CAD knowledge; learn client standards, practices, and procedures to ensure that work produced conforms to the client's standards and expectations; be responsible for knowing and following POWER's standards, procedures, and processes; collaborate on design issues; seek guidance from those with more experience; and mentor/direct those with less experience.
- Associates degree (or equivalent education/experience) in drafting, engineering technology, architecture, or other technical discipline.
- Proficient in AutoCAD and/or MicroStation.
- The candidate must have strong command of the English language with good written and oral communication skills in order to work effectively with other team members.
- Candidates must be legally authorized to work permanently in the U.S. without the need for work sponsorship.
- Drafting, modeling, and/or design experience in Inventor, or AutoCAD Electrical.
- Knowledge of utility level (medium to high voltage) electrical substations.
